The Phases of ACL Physiotherapy
Early Rehab (Weeks 06)
Goal: Manage swelling, restore full knee extension, regain quadriceps activation.
Key interventions: Cryotherapy, leg lifts, heel slides, electrical muscle stimulation.
Mid-Stage Strengthening (Weeks 716)
Goal: Build full range of motion and knee strength.
Exercises: Closed-chain movementsbodyweight squats, step-ups, mini-lunges, leg presses.
Advanced Performance Training (Weeks 1728)
Goal: Sport-specific agility, speed, balance.
Drills: Plyometrics, jumping, change-of-direction drills.
Return to Sport (Months 79+)
Goal: Finally, full soccer integration.
Returned with guided scrimmages, progressive field training, injury prevention combos.
Key Rehab Components
Quad strength: Crucial for knee stability during sports.
Hamstring activation: To reduce stress on the ACL.
Proprioception: Balance work using wobble boards; reactive neuromuscular training.
Functional drills: Lunging, pivoting, agility ladder, sport-specific direction changes.
My Turning Point
At around Month 5, I completed a hop test battery (single-leg hop for distance, triple hop, crossover hops) and passed with symmetrythis confidence booster marked the start of my return to soccer practices.
How Physiotherapy Makes the Difference
Structured protocols: Based on evidence-based ACL return-to-play criteria.
Objective testing: Like isokinetic strength testing and hop symmetry reduced injury risk.
Education & compliance: Understanding safe load progression prevented re-injury.
Tips for Athletes Recovering from ACL Injuries
Choose a physiotherapist experienced in ACL rehab and sports return-to-play programs.
Focus on neuromuscular trainingbalance, coordination, strength.
Dont rush: ACL tissue takes time. Follow clinical milestones like 90% strength symmetry.
Combine sport-specific drills gradually as you regain confidence.
Use video analysis and biomechanical feedback to ensure proper movement quality.
